Question
For which of the following, diagonals bisect each other?
Options
Square
Kite
Trapezium
Quadrilateral
Advertisements
Solution
Square
Explanation:
We know that, the diagonals of a square bisect each other but the diagonals of kite, trapezium and quadrilateral do not bisect each other.
